The revelation that Mr. Forkle had a twin brother (and thus the persona of Forkle was shared by two individuals) recontextualizes every interaction Sophie has had with her creator up to that point. This twist subverts the reader’s trust in the narrative authority of the Black Swan, reinforcing one of the series' core themes: that authority figures, even benevolent ones, often obscure the truth.

Flashback is often cited by fans as the book where the series “grows up.” It tackles consent (magical healing without permission), survivor’s guilt, and the weight of leadership.
